Titanoboa snakes

Based on the researches on its fossils, the Titanoboa was the longest snake that ever lived in the world.  Its fossils found in La Guajira in northeastern Colombia and researchers believes it was about 12-15 meters (39-49 feet) in length.

Reticulated python snakes

The second position in our list belongs to the Reticulated Python with over 10 meters (32 feet) in length. However, it is the longest snake among the living snakes in the world. It is a nonvenomous constrictor snake that feeds on mammals and occasionally birds but there are reports about people who were killed or eaten by this snake.

The Reticulated Python lives in Southeast Asia. It is a good swimmer that lives. In some areas, people hunt it for its beautiful skin. In addition, the natives use it in traditional medicine. Hunting the Reticulated Python is popular for sale as pets!

Amethystine Python Snakes

The Amethystine Python reached the 3rd position among the top 10 biggest snakes in the world because of the reports that show it can reach up to 8.5 meters (28 feet) in length! This beautiful giant is popular among reptile enthusiasts because of its amazing color.

The Amethystine Python is native to Indonesia, Papua New Guinea and Australia and this non-venomous constrictor snake feeds on small mammals and birds, bats and rodents.

green anaconda Snakes

The stories said Green Anaconda eat humans but there isn’t valid evidence to confirm this claim. This green giant reached up to 7 meters (23 feet) and can gain the 4th position on our list.

It is also known as the giant emerald anaconda, common anaconda, common water boa and sucuri. You can find green anaconda in South America and Caribbean Islands and it is usually aquatic. And it is like other Boas non-venomous constrictors that feed on birds, mammals, fish and reptiles.

Aafrican Rock Python Snakes

The 5th position in our list belongs to the African Rock Python the longest record length of it is 5.8 m (19 ft) in the former Transvaal. Although, there is a strange claim that people found a 7 m African Rock Python while there was a Nile crocodile in its stomach!

This gain snake, as mentioned in its name, live in Africa and you will find two subspecies of it: Northern African rock python (Python sebae sebae) and Southern African rock python (Python sebae natalensis).

Like other Pythons, its species is a nonvenomous constrictor snake that feeds on other animals.

Burmese Python Snakes

It is another nonvenomous constrictor snake belonging to the groups of Pythons. The length of this beautiful snake is between 3.47 m (11 ft 5 in) to 5.74 m (18 ft 10 in) and the females are longer than males. Hence, the Burmese python is put in the 6th position on our list.

You will find this dark-coloured snake with brown spots in South-East Asia while feeding on small animals such as birds, rodents and other rabbits.

king cobra Snakes

It is really deserved to be the king of the snakes’ world. This beautiful and fearsome snake is in the 7th position among the world’s top 10 most giant snakes, with over 5.7 meters (18.7 feet). However, King Cobra is the longest venomous snake in the world too.

King Cobra is native to India and Southeast Asia. If you have a trip to this region, be careful about it because if it supposes you are a threat will attack you by rearing up its body and showing its hood with a hissssssss song.

black mamba Snakes

Black Mamba put in the 8th position with 4.3 meters (14.11 feet).

It is very dangerous! Black Mamba is not only one of the largest snakes in the world, but it’s also very fast and aggressive. In addition, Black Mamba is one of the most venomous snakes found in South and East African savannas.

If you seek to see Black Mamba close, you can find it while sleeping in hollow trees and rocky hills in tropical or temperate areas in Africa.

They feed on birds, small mammals and bats.

olive python Snakes

The 9th position belongs to the Olive Python with over 4 meters (13 feet) in length! It is named because of its color: olive green. Hence it is one of the most beautiful snakes in the world.

Olive pythons live in Australia. although it is nonvenomous it like others in its family is a powerful constrictor that can feed on small animals such as other reptiles, small mammals and birds.

Boa Constrictor Snakes

The 10th position belongs to one of the most popular snakes among fans of reptiles: Boa Constrictors and also known as a red-tailed boa. Its length is 2.1 – 3 m for adult females and 1.8 – 2.4 m for adult males.

Boa Constrictor is not dangerous for humans and the attractive color of this snake is the main reason for its popularity. This beautiful snake is native to tropical South America and feeds on small animals like mice, rats, lizards and bats.
